Savol №1 C++ tili kim tomonidan yaratilgan? +a Straustrup b Richchi c Kernigan va D. Ritchi d Kernigan Savol №2


Download 431.03 Kb.
bet15/15
Sana13.10.2023
Hajmi431.03 Kb.
#1701262
1   ...   7   8   9   10   11   12   13   14   15
Bog'liq
1.Dasturlash 1 uzb

? : bu qanday ifoda ?

  1. *Shartli ifoda

  2. Qisqa ko`paytirish

  3. Qisqa bo`lish

  4. Funksiyani chaqirish




  1. Do while qanday operator ?

  1. Tarmoqlanuvchi

  2. *Takrorlanuvchi

  3. Sharli operator

  4. Tanlash operatori




  1. Ifodani ekranga chiqaradigan amalni kursating

Int a=1;
Switch(a)
{
Case 1: cout<<”1”;
Case 2: cout<<”2”;
Case 3: cout<<”3”;
}

  1. *1 chiqadi

  2. 2 chiqadi

  3. 3 chiqadi

  4. 123 chiqadi




  1. M[10][10][10] massiv necha ulchamli massiv ?

  1. 10 ulchamli

  2. 30 ulchamli

  3. *3 ulchamli

  4. To`g`ri javob yuq




  1. Ifodani ekranga chiqaradigan amalni kursating

Int a=10;
Switch(a)
{
Case 1: cout<<”1”; break;
Case 10: cout<<”2”; break;
Case 20: cout<<”3”; break;
}

  1. 1 chiqadi

  2. *2 chiqadi

  3. 3 chiqadi

  4. 123 chiqadi




  1. Float M[1.5]=2.5; qiymat berish mumkinmi ?

  1. Elon qilish mumkin

  2. *Elon qilish mumkin emas

  3. Agar haqiqiy tipda bo`lsa

  4. a va c javoblar to`g`ri


  1. Quyidagi ifodani qiymatini toping ?

S=0;
for(int h=1; h<=10; h++)
S+=h;
Cout<

  1. 25

  2. *55

  3. To`g`ri javob mavjud emas

  4. 35




  1. Do while bilan while ni farqi ?

  1. *While shart to`g`ri bo`lsa ishlaydi do while bajarib shart tekshiradi

  2. Do while shart to`g`ri bo`lsa ishlaydi while bajarib shart tekshiradi

  3. Farqi yuq

  4. To`g`ri javob yuq




  1. C++ dasturlash tilidi 2 o`lchovli haqiqiy toifali massivlar qanday e`lon qilinadi?

  1. *float a[i][j]

  2. float a[i,j]

  3. float a(i)(j)

  4. float a{I,J}



  1. Faylni yopuvchi protseduralarni ko’rsating

  1. Rewrite

  2. *Close

  3. Reset

  4. Assign



  1. Shartsiz o’tish operatori qaysi jovobda to’g’ri ko’rsatilgan?

  1. For..to..do..

  2. For..downto..do..

  3. Case..of..end

  4. *Go to n



  1. C++ tilida yozuvlardagi o’zgarmaslar, o’zgaruvchilar, belgilar, turlar, ob’ektlar, protseduralar, funksiyalar, modullar, dasturlar va maydonlarning nomlari:- bu

  1. Direktivalar

  2. Rezerv so’zlar

  3. Belgilar

  4. *Identifikatorlar

  1. Uzgaruvchilarning sonli qiymat uzlashtirish tartibini kursating: a=b=c=10;

  1. a,b,c

  2. a,c,b

  3. b,c,a

  4. *c,b,a




  1. siklni keyingi bosh iteratsiyasiga boshqaruvni qaysi operator yuboradi?

  1. *Continue

  2. If

  3. Switch

  4. Break



  1. Izoh qanday belgilanadi?





  1. *



  1. C++ dasturlash tilida funksiyani e`lon qilish qanday amalga oshiriladi:

  1. *Funksiya tipi, nomi (…)

  2. ()funksiya tipi, nomi {…}

  3. funksiya tipi, nomi {…} (…)

  4. {…}funksiya tipi, nomi




  1. Fayllar bilan ishlash uchun dasturga qaysi sarlavxali faylni qushish lozim?

  1. stdio.h

  2. iostream.h

  3. conio.h

  4. *fstream.h



  1. C++ dasturlash tilida #include kalit so`zi nimani bildiradi

  1. *barcha dasturlash biblotekalariga murojaatni ta`minlaydi

  2. Dasturdagi barcha funktsiyalarga murojaatni ta`minlaydi

  3. Sinflarga murojaatni ta`minlaydi

  4. Dasturlash tilida bunday kalit so`z mavjud emas



  1. Quyidagi ifodani qiymati toping.

Bool a=true;
If(!a)
{
Cout<<”C++ da dasturlash”;
}
else cout<<”C++”;

  1. C++ da dasturlash

  2. Hech qanday yozuv chiqmaydi

  3. To`g`ri javob yuq

  4. *C++



  1. Goto qanday operator ?

  1. *Shartsiz utish operatori

  2. Tanlash operatori

  3. Operator emas

  4. To`g`ri javob yuq

  1. Quyidagi ifodani qiymatini hisoblang

Int k=10, h=5;
h+=k++;
cout<

  1. h=10, k=5;

  2. *h=15, k=6;

  3. h=6, k=10;

  4. h=15, k=5;

  1. void funk(); funksiya qanday qiymat qaytaradi ?

  1. Butun qiymat

  2. Haqiqiy qiymat

  3. *Qiymat qaytarmaydi

  4. Mantiqiy funksiya

  1. Rekursiv funksiya nima ?

  1. Tartiblaydigan funksiya

  2. *O`zini o`zi chaqiruvchi funksiya

  3. a, b javoblar to`g`ri

  4. to`g`ri javob yuq

  1. int tipining ishlash chegarasi to'g'ri ko'rsatilgan javobni belgilang

  1. -32767 => 32767

  2. *-65535 => 65535

  3. 0 => 32767

  4. 0 => 65535



  1. c++ da qaysi kutubxona ishlamaydi



  1. *





  1. Oqimli kiritish va chiqarishda ma’lumotlar bilan almashish qanday amalga oshiriladi?

  1. *ketma-ket

  2. baytma-bayt

  3. faqat bitlarda

  4. barcha javoblar to'g'ri



  1. Kutubxonalarni chaqirish qanday nomlanadi?

  1. Identifikator

  2. Direktiva

  3. Interface

  4. *Include

  1. Butun qiymatli Funksiya e'loni to'g'ri ko'rsatilgan javobni ko'sating.

  1. *int Sum(int a,int b)

  2. Sum(int a, int b)

  3. int Sum(a, b)

  4. hamma javoblar to`g`ri



  1. Qaysi saralash algoritmi

for (int i=0; i < n-1; i++)
pos_min = i;
for (int j=i+1; j < n; j++)
if (arr[j] < arr[pos_min])
pos_min=j;

  1. Insertion sort

  2. Merge sort

  3. *Seliction sort

  4. Quick sort

  1. simollar yoki satrlar C++ da qaysi tip bilan e'lon qilinadi

  1. float, char

  2. string, double

  3. *char, string

  4. string, int

  1. C++ tilining kalit so'zlariga qaysi so'zlar kiradi.

  1. *asm, auto, break, case, char, class,delete, do, double,else,

  2. mint, double,integer,break, case, char, class,acm, or,

  3. asm, break, or, auto, mint, include, stdio, iomanip,

  4. break, char, include, iostream, double, string, graphics,

  1. C++ da qanaqa amallar bajaradi.

fabs(x)

  1. butun sonlar uchun daraja amali

  2. butun sonlar uchun modul amali

  3. *haqiqiy sonlar uchun modul amali

  4. simvollar uchun almashtirish amali

  1. Qanday amal ekranga chiqariladi.

for(int i=0; i<=255; i++)
cout << (char)i <<' ';

  1. 0 dan 255 gacha sonlar

  2. 256 ta simvol o'chiriladi

  3. 0 dan 256 gacha simvollar

  4. *0 dan 255 simvollar

  1. Butun qiymatli Funksiya e'loni to'g'ri ko'rsatilgan javobni ko'sating.

  1. int Sum(int a,int b)

b) Sum(int a, int b)
c) int Sum(a, int b)
d) int Sum(a, int c)


  1. Ushbu dastur kodi qaysi saralash algoritmiga ta'luqli?

for (int i=0; i < n-1; i++)
pos_min = i;
for (int j=i+1; j < n; j++)
if (arr[j] < arr[pos_min])
pos_min=j;
====
Insertion sort
====
Merge sort
====
#Seliction sort
====
Quick sort

+++++



  1. Simvollar yoki satrlar C++da qaysi tip bilan e'lon qilinadi?

====
float, char
====
string, double
====
#char, string
====
string, int

+++++



  1. C++ tilining kalit so'zlariga qaysi so'zlar kiradi?

====
#asm, auto, break, case, char, class,delete, do, double,else,
====
mint, double,integer,break, case, char, class,acm, or,
====
asm, break, or, auto, mint, include, stdio, iomanip,
====
break, char, include, iostream, double, string, graphics,

+++++



  1. C++ da qanaqa amallar bajaradi.

fabs(x)
====
butun sonlar uchun daraja amali
====
butun sonlar uchun modul amali
====
#haqiqiy sonlar uchun modul amali
====
simvollar uchun almashtirish amali

+++++



  1. Ushbu dastur kodida qanday natija ekranga chiqariladi?

for(int i=0; i<=255; i++)
cout << (char)i <<' ';
====
0 dan 255 gacha sonlar
====
256 ta simvol o'chiriladi
====
0 dan 256 gacha simvollar
====
#0 dan 255 simvollar



Download 431.03 Kb.

Do'stlaringiz bilan baham:
1   ...   7   8   9   10   11   12   13   14   15




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ling